Public bug reported: Binary package hint: screen-profiles
I am thrilled with the work Dustin Kirkland has done to provide useful screen profiles. One of the features is that the hardstatus line on the bottom will show the number of available package updates in white text against a red background. After manually installing all available updates via aptitude full- upgrade, that status does not change until apt-check is called again. >From perusing the updates-available script in /usr/share/screen- profiles/bin/, it seems that it will update hourly.
